Originally Posted by Packrat
Well, then you're going to have to explain to me why 3 or 4 guys I know of got 747 classes BEFORE guys who were in the pool longer. The answer seems to be all 4 lived in ANC.
Ummm and in addition to what was posted above, there is nothing in the way of pool seniority with HR. They hire who they want when they want and no one is entitled to a class date sooner just because they've been "in the pool longer." That is how it works with most jobs.
